PDA

View Full Version : TEST Patch Y11 - East Asian Support


Scawen
29th February 2008, 17:42
WARNING : THIS IS A TEST

Hello Racers.

Here is a new compatible test patch Y11.

It contains Chinese, Japanese and Korean Translations.
There are also some fixes including a hot lapping fix affecting South City.
Please read the list of changes below.


Changes in TEST PATCH Y11 :

Name of active Chinese input method is now shown (but not in Vista)
New game setup screen info message "X removed Y from the start grid"
FIX : Speedo and tacho numbers and text appeared above the needle
FIX : Low ASCII characters can no longer be read from text files
FIX : Previously missing fonts should now appear in the list
FIX : Repeating message "could not get input context"


Changes from Y to Y10 :

Double byte character support :

Included Chinese, Japanese and Korean translations
Selectable fonts for these languages in Game Options
Input Method Editor support including candidate lists
IME automatically switched on and off in text entry dialog
Input language is shown when editing text (white if IME active)

Interface :

Faster text drawing system improves frame rate
Separate text entry field for AI number plates
Welcome screen now has three columns of languages
Added flags beside names of translations in Game Options
Czech / Japanese / Simplified Chinese lesson translations
Network debug messages are no longer sent in InSim packets
Text input box is now drawn above user messages so easier to type
Line breaks in help text and lesson text now depend on actual width
FIX : Corrupted text in top left corner after changing language
FIX : Corrupted "finished" at top right after changing language

Multiplayer :

New command /ndebug=no/yes to switch off/on network debug
Dedicated host and network debug show connecting guest IP
FIX : Rapid /ai NAME command resulted in AI with same name
FIX : Rapid /ai command could exceed number of cars allowed
FIX : Joining a host with same name AI resulted in Join OOS
FIX : Skin name buffer overflow exploit

Fixes :

FIX : Replay could open reversed configuration in DEMO
FIX : Wall riding was possible on soft walls at South City
FIX : Could select invalid configuration and weather in cfg.txt
FIX : Admin could crash dedicated host by mistake with some commands


DOWNLOAD :

PATCH Y11 (Version Y must already be installed) :
www.liveforspeed.net/file_lfs.php?name=LFS_PATCH_Y_TO_Y11.exe (1.5 MB)

DEDICATED HOST (for hosting only) :
www.liveforspeed.net/file_lfs.php?name=LFS_S2_DEDI_Y11.zip


KNOWN ISSUES :

Russian and Slovenian flags appear to be radioactive
Dedicated host does not display double byte characters
Name of active Chinese input method is not shown in Vista
In game text can sometimes appear blurred (not reproducable)


Windows XP : East Asian Language Support / Font Installation

LFS does not support double byte characters with Windows 98 / ME. Windows XP and Vista should work well but you may need to install fonts.

If you have Windows XP and currently cannot see the East Asian translations, here's how to set up your computer so it works.
See the attachment - in Control Panel click on "Regional and Language Options" then under the "Languages" tab select "Install files for East Asian Languages".
Windows will probably ask you to get your XP CD and the fonts will be installed from it.

This is important even if you do not use Chinese, Japanese or Korean translations so you can see East Asian text and player names correctly when you are online.

mcgas001
29th February 2008, 17:43
SamH "Where are you" Thanks Scawen :D

ussbeethoven
29th February 2008, 17:44
New game setup screen info message "X removed Y from the start grid"
FIX : Speedo and tacho numbers and text appeared above the needle
Good work, thanks. :thumb:

RacerAsh3
29th February 2008, 17:45
Lovely jubley :)

SamH
29th February 2008, 18:21
Brilliant!! I can't thank you enough!! :thumb:

ldriver
29th February 2008, 18:24
Something wrong here , when i start lfs i get the screen as attached .
If i do shift+f4 twice it all comes back normal.

LFSn00b
29th February 2008, 18:56
Ok, i've installed this new patch, and i don't seem able to play Live For Speed. Maybe it's because of the new fonts. I cannot install them via CP so is there any chance to download some installer thingymabob to install these new fonts or something?



EDIT: here's the XFire crash report
<?xml version="1.0" encoding="utf-8" ?>

<ExceptionReport Version="4">
<Application Build="30130" Command="&quot;C:\Users\Niko\Desktop\LFS S2Y\LFS.exe&quot; "/>
<OperatingSystem Type="2"><Version Major="6" Minor="0" Build="6000"/></OperatingSystem>
<Exception Code="C0000005" Address="684CDA66"><Module Section="0001" Offset="0001CA66" FileName="C:\Windows\system32\atiumdag.dll"/></Exception>
<Registers EAX="00000000" EBX="03193AA4" ECX="00000000" EDX="00000003" ESI="03191160" EDI="00000000" CS="001B" EIP="684CDA66" SS="0023" ESP="0012FC4C" EBP="031920A4" DS="0023" ES="0023" FS="003B" GS="0000" Flags="00010206"/>
<BackTrace>
<Frame ProgramCounter="684CDA66" StackAddress="0012FC4C" FrameAddress="031920A4">
<Module Section="0001" Offset="0001CA66" FileName="C:\Windows\system32\atiumdag.dll"/>
<StackHexDump From="0012FC4C" To="0012FCCC">73 bf 4c 68 60 11 19 03 94 fc 12 00 a8 dc 1d 03 c6 2b 4c 68 03 00 00 00 60 44 2f 00 01 00 00 00 76 27 4b 68 03 00 00 00 9e 01 42 6c 60 11 19 03 8c fc 12 00 01 00 00 00 a0 37 31 00 00 00 00 00 01 00 00 00 03 00 00 00 cc fc 12 00 fd c9 40 6c 01 00 00 00 03 00 00 00 0e fe 63 64 01 00 00 00 d0 36 b7 00 a0 3a 31 00 2e 7f 54 00 00 00 00 00 a4 fc 12 00 90 ff 12 00 00 e5 4a 6c 02 00 00 00</StackHexDump>
</Frame>
</BackTrace>
</ExceptionReport>

minichris502
29th February 2008, 19:40
thingymabob? :smileypul

LFSn00b
29th February 2008, 19:43
thingymabob? :smileypulYes :D

germanpio
29th February 2008, 19:56
Something wrong here , when i start lfs i get the screen as attached .
If i do shift+f4 twice it all comes back normal.


Same problem here, but switching display mode fixes it.

aroX123
29th February 2008, 20:53
Sry askin, but will you just keep on to you fix.. yea most of the bugs, and then start at patch z?

tristancliffe
29th February 2008, 20:54
He will keep working until he's satisifed with the new patch and when most of the bugs are free. Then he'll probably have a week off (test patch coding is hard work), and then start on the next stuff, whatever that may be.

aroX123
29th February 2008, 20:56
(test patch coding is hard work)
Yes, i dont understand how... HE'S SO DAMN GOOD.

dawesdust_12
29th February 2008, 21:18
I'm getting the same crash as Niko. Vista error report thingie contains this:

Problem signature:
Problem Event Name: APPCRASH
Application Name: LFS.exe
Application Version: 0.0.0.0
Application Timestamp: 47c84011
Fault Module Name: atiumdag.dll
Fault Module Version: 7.14.10.510
Fault Module Timestamp: 4671ee2e
Exception Code: c0000005
Exception Offset: 0001d5f6
OS Version: 6.0.6000.2.0.0.256.1
Locale ID: 1033
Additional Information 1: e5a6
Additional Information 2: df97b1df27f14b186700928520c33241
Additional Information 3: 7849
Additional Information 4: 83098f647828ecf02e8f73007e0ec37d

Scawen
29th February 2008, 21:34
Is that every time you start LFS?

dawesdust_12
29th February 2008, 21:41
Invariably. I reverted back to Y10, and it works flawlessly. Y11 seems to be offbounds for me for now.

Waffenaffe
29th February 2008, 21:51
Problem,help me <.<
I´ve updated from Y10
http://img135.imageshack.us/my.php?image=unbenannttn0.jpg
Maybe you can help.

€Dit says: I have since Y10 the Problem,that i disconnect from servers with the Message"Avoiding Buffer crash(OK)" sometimes every 10 minutes..

Doorman
29th February 2008, 22:16
Something wrong here , when i start lfs i get the screen as attached .
If i do shift+f4 twice it all comes back normal.
Me too.

Scawen
29th February 2008, 22:21
To those who get the crash or the corrupted entry screen, please could you try this attached exe and see if it fixes the problem. I just rolled back one change I made.

If this works ok we'll know that change was the cause of the problem.

dawesdust_12
29th February 2008, 22:24
Loads for me now :)

Waffenaffe
29th February 2008, 22:28
Works fine now,Thank you Scawen!

ldriver
29th February 2008, 22:31
Works fine here too , thanks :)

LFSn00b
29th February 2008, 22:44
Works fine here too, thanks Scawen :thumb:



You could also make a line 'X added AI Y' if that is possible?

Doorman
29th February 2008, 22:46
Sorted! :thumb:

mcgas001
29th February 2008, 22:49
Works fine here too, thanks Scawen :thumb:



You could also make a line 'X added AI Y' if that is possible?

Please let's not slip into the idea that this is a requests thread.

If that does happen, I'll end up getting annoyed, and close the test patch forum and get on with what I need to do, in peace.

I rest my case.

Scawen
29th February 2008, 23:17
Thanks for the testing and sorry about that crash / texture bug. It was an attempt at a minor optimisation but was not thought through enough so for some reason it went wrong on some computers.

Fix posted on Y12 thread :

http://www.lfsforum.net/showthread.php?t=39729